Brigitte Macron: A Life Story Unfolding
Brigitte Marie-Claude Trogneux, who we now know as Brigitte Macron, has a life story that’s certainly quite unique, wouldn't you say? Born in Amiens, France, her early years were, in some respects, fairly typical for someone from a well-established family. Her family, the Trogneux family, has a long history in the chocolate-making business, which is a sweet detail, literally. This background, you know, provided a certain foundation for her life before she stepped into the very public role she holds today.
Early Years and Education
Her younger days saw her pursuing an education that led her into the teaching profession. She studied literature and earned a CAPES, which is a teaching certificate in France, so she was quite dedicated to her studies. She taught French and Latin, and later, theater, at various schools. This period of her life, teaching, was a very significant part of her identity for many years, giving her a direct connection with young people and their development. It's almost easy to forget that she spent so much time in classrooms, shaping young minds, before her current position, isn't it?
It was during her time teaching at Lycée La Providence in Amiens that she met Emmanuel Macron, then a student. Their relationship, which developed over time, has been a subject of much discussion and, in a way, has defined a large part of her public narrative. This period of her life, as a teacher and then as a partner, really set the stage for everything that followed, apparently.

The Path to Public Life
Brigitte Macron’s path to becoming France’s First Lady was, naturally, tied to Emmanuel Macron’s political rise. She left her teaching career in 2015 to fully support his political ambitions, a pretty significant step, if you think about it. Her involvement in his campaigns was quite visible; she was often by his side, offering advice and support. This wasn't just a casual presence, either; she was very much an active participant in his journey to the presidency, helping him refine his public image and speeches, you know.
When Emmanuel Macron became President in 2017, Brigitte stepped into the role of First Lady, a position that, in France, is not formally defined by law but carries considerable public expectation. Her transition from a relatively private life as a teacher to a highly scrutinized public figure was, quite frankly, a huge adjustment. She has since carved out her own space within this role, focusing on education, culture, and supporting charitable causes, demonstrating a clear commitment to public service, as a matter of fact.
Personal Details and Biographical Data
Here’s a quick look at some key details about Brigitte Macron. These facts help us get a clearer picture of her background and life path, so you can see them all in one place.
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Brigitte Marie-Claude Trogneux |
Born | April 13, 1953 |
Birthplace | Amiens, France |
Current Age (as of 2024) | 71 years old |
Spouse | Emmanuel Macron (married 2007) |
Children | Sébastien Auzière, Laurence Auzière-Jourdan, Tiphaine Auzière (from previous marriage) |
Profession (Former) | Teacher (French, Latin, Theater) |
Current Role | First Lady of France |

Her Public Role and Influence
As France’s First Lady, Brigitte Macron has shaped her role in a way that feels quite personal to her. She doesn't just stand by her husband's side; she actively engages in various initiatives. She has a particular passion for education, given her background as a teacher, and often visits schools, advocating for better learning conditions and opportunities for young people. This is a very direct way she makes an impact, you know.
She also supports cultural projects and works with charities that help vulnerable children and people with disabilities. Her presence at official events, both in France and internationally, is pretty significant. She uses her platform to draw attention to causes she cares about, and she often serves as a kind of informal ambassador for France, projecting an image of warmth and engagement. Her influence, you could say, extends beyond formal duties, reaching into areas where her personal touch can make a real difference, apparently.

How old is Brigitte Macron?
Brigitte Macron was born on April 13, 1953, which means she is 71 years old as of 2024. The keyword "Brigitte Macron age 40" often comes up, but that refers to a much earlier period in her life. She is quite a bit older than 40 now, you know.
What was Brigitte Macron's profession before becoming First Lady?
Before stepping into her current public role, Brigitte Macron was a teacher. She taught French, Latin, and theater at various schools in France. This background in education is something she often references and continues to champion in her work as First Lady, very much so.
What is Brigitte Macron's relationship with Emmanuel Macron?
Brigitte Macron is married to Emmanuel Macron, the current President of France. Their relationship began when he was her student at Lycée La Providence in Amiens. They married in 2007. Their age difference has often been a topic of public discussion, but their bond seems very strong and supportive, to be honest.
